Time-dependent Bell inequalities in a Wigner form

N.V. Nikitin$^1$, V.P. Sotnikov$^1$, K.S. Toms$^2$

Moscow University Physics Bulletin 2014. 69. N 6. P. 480

  • Article
Annotation

We propose time-dependent Bell inequalities in a Wigner form, which expand the possibilities of experimental verification of Bohr’s principle of complementarity in the relativistic domain and for nonstationary quantum-mechanical systems. Derivation of the proposed inequalities is based entirely on the Kolmogorov axiomatics of probability theory and the locality hypothesis. Violation of the obtained inequalities is considered in the framework of quantum theory based on the example of oscillations of neutral B mesons.
